Angaston (34°30′S 190°03′E) is a town in the Barossa Valley, South Australia, 77km north east of Adelaide. Its elevation is 347m, one of the highest points in the valley, and has an average rainfall of 561mm. Angaston was originally known as German Pass, but later was named after George Fife Angas, who settled in the area in the 1850s.
